Graham Andrew Chipchase {{postnominals|country=GBR|size=100%|CBE}} (born 17 January 1963) is a British businessman. He is the chief executive officer (CEO) of Brambles, an Australian logistics company.

In the 2024 Birthday Honours, Graham Chipchase was appointed a Commander of the Order of the British Empire (CBE) for services to sustainable business.{{cite web |url=https://assets.publishing.service.gov.uk/media/6669879843c77d8616f76033/Birthday_Honours_List_2024.pdf |title=Awards for Birthday Honours List 2024}}

Early life

He has a bachelor's degree in chemistry from Oriel College, University of Oxford.

Career

Chipchase was announced as the incoming CEO of Australian-based company Brambles Limited on 18 August 2016.http://www.brambles.com/Content/cms/news/2016/160818_-_CEO_Retirement_and_Appointment_of_Successor.pdf {{Bare URL PDF|date=March 2022}} Chipchase commenced with Brambles as CEO designate on 1 January 2017, working with outgoing CEO Tom Gorman for a two-month transitional period until he assumed the role as CEO on 1 March 2017.

Previously Chipchase had been the CEO of Rexam since 4 January 2010, joining the company as finance director on 10 March 2003.

Chipchase started his career with Coopers & Lybrand, where he trained as a chartered accountant. Later he joined BOC Group, serving as corporate finance manager since 1990, rising to director of planning and financial control. In 2001, he joined GKN, as finance director of its aerospace services business.{{cite web|url=http://investing.businessweek.com/research/stocks/people/person.asp?personId=3573452&ticker=REX:LN&previousCapId=876890&previousTitle=G4S%20PLC |title=Graham Chipchase: Executive Profile |publisher=BusinessWeek|date=|accessdate=7 February 2015}}{{dead link|date=April 2023|bot=medic}}{{cbignore|bot=medic}}{{cite web|url=http://www.rexam.com/index.asp?pageid=753|title=Meet Graham Chipchase, Chief Executive|publisher=Rexam|date=|accessdate=21 November 2012|archive-date=6 November 2012|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20121106094236/http://www.rexam.com/index.asp?pageid=753|url-status=dead}}

Chipchase was a non-executive director at AstraZeneca from 2012 to 2021.{{cite web|title=Our leadership team|url=https://www.astrazeneca.com/our-company/leadership.html#modal-generic|website=AstraZeneca|accessdate=31 July 2017}}
